#d03733 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d03733 is composed of 81.6% red, 21.6%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.6% magenta, 75.5%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 1.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.5% and a lightness of 50.8%. #d03733 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e66 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d03733 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d03733 has RGB values of R:208, G:55,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.75,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13645619.

Shades and Tints of #d03733
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d03733
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838080 is the less saturated color, while #f7120c is the most saturated one.
